>I'm trying to compile MPI V7.0.6 on IRIX6.5 and stuck at the "make" step. The errors are pasted as following and I appreciate any of your suggestion to help me out:
>
>*************************error message attachment*************
>
> cc-1035 CC: WARNING File = /usr/include/CC/iostream, Line = 18
> #error directive: This header file requires the -LANG:std option
>
> #error This header file requires the -LANG:std option
> ^
>
>
It seems that this version of LAM requires you to use the new (standard)
iostreams. With the MipsPro compiler you must be using, you get the old
iostreams, unless you add the option -LANG:std. Apparently the config
for this compiler doesn't add that option for you. If you don't know
how to add compiler flags, check the installation docs.
